Entry Level Operations Associate – Corporate Reorganization

M&T Bank

Entry Level Operations Associate processing corporate actions for publicly traded securities in financial services. Joining a team focused on accuracy and timeliness in corporate reorganization.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Process and reconcile corporate actions, including mandatory events such as mergers, restructurings, and entitlement postings to client accounts
  • Interpret and validate data from internal systems and external vendors to ensure accuracy of client holdings and transaction activity
  • Perform account balancing, suspense reconciliation, and exception research to resolve discrepancies
  • Support high-volume, detail-oriented transaction processing across cash, securities, and asset movements
  • Partner with internal teams including Financial Advisors, Investment Managers, and Operations to resolve transaction-related issues
  • Complete independent verification of transactions processed by team members to ensure accuracy and control integrity
  • Monitor shared team inboxes to manage incoming requests, prioritize work, and meet service level expectations
  • Assist in processing class actions and other corporate event-related activities tied to client holdings
  • Identify, escalate, and help resolve risk, compliance, or control issues in accordance with regulatory and internal standards
  • Contribute to process improvement efforts to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and client experience
